Hyderabad, March 9, 2026 – Newlyweds Vijay Deverakonda and Rashmika Mandanna are back on set for their upcoming Telugu historical drama Ranabaali (also known as VD14). Production restarts today, with the lead pair joining from March 12. Fans are excited as this marks their first film work together after their February 26 wedding in Udaipur.Directed by Rahul Sankrityan (Taxiwaala, Shyam Singha Roy), Ranabaali promises a gripping tale of courage, rebellion, and survival. The first look video, released on Monday, shows Vijay in a fierce warrior avatar amid rugged southern Indian landscapes.Story and Historical SettingSet in the late 1800s, the film draws from the Great Famine of 1876–1878, a deadly crisis that hit southern India hard, including Rayalaseema in present-day Andhra Pradesh. It portrays ordinary people fighting colonial oppression, violence, and hardship.Vijay Deverakonda plays Ranabaali, a fearless freedom fighter. Rashmika Mandanna stars as Jayamma, his devoted wife, adding emotional depth. Set against the romantic backdrop of Rajasthan’s palaces and lakes, the ceremony was intimate yet breathtakingly elegant.A Love Story Years in the MakingThe journey of Vijay and Rashmika began on film sets. The two actors first starred together in the blockbuster Telugu film Geetha Govindam and later reunited for Dear Comrade. Their on-screen chemistry quickly turned them into one of the most loved pairs in Indian cinema.Over the years, rumours about their relationship frequently surfaced, but both actors kept their personal lives private.
